Phoenix weather today brings partly sunny skies and a high near 95°F, but here’s what you need to know: Sunday morning will be breezy to windy across the Valley, with gusts reaching 25 mph and stronger winds possible in the higher terrain east of Phoenix toward the Superstition Mountains.
The National Weather Service is tracking a strengthening high-pressure system moving into the Southern Plains tonight, which will set up a strong pressure gradient across Arizona. This means enhanced easterly winds will kick in during the pre-dawn hours and continue through mid-morning. If you’re planning an early hike at Camelback Mountain or South Mountain Park, wait until afternoon when conditions calm down—the morning winds could stir up some dust, especially in the foothills east of the city.
